Mackerel, Vanilla, Gooseberry, Horseradish, Lovage Recipe - Great British Chefs
This dish by Chef Gabriel Waterhouse layers acidity beautifully - cured mackerel is paired with vanilla-scented pickled gooseberries, a yoghurt and lovage emulsion and horseradish cream.
Ingredients
- 300g of gooseberries, fresh or frozen
- 300g of cane sugar
- 300ml of white wine vinegar
- 300ml of water
- 1 vanilla pod, split
- 2 whole mackerel, filleted
- 13g of fennel seeds
- 13g of coriander seeds
- 250g of table salt, plus 30g extra for the brine
- 125g of cane sugar
- 1 lemon, zested
- oil for greasing
- 500ml of double cream
- 100g of creamed horseradish
- 100g of fresh horseradish, grated
- 1 lemon, juiced
- 4g of agar agar
- 100g of fresh lovage, leaves only
- 300ml of vegetable oil
- 2 egg yolks
- 10mm of Dijon mustard
- 7ml of white wine vinegar
- 5g of salt
- 20ml of lemon juice
- 100g of thick yoghurt
- nasturtium leaves
- bronze fennel
